DHS USCIS - Technical Writing Services - Market Research

Description

The Department of Homeland Security (DHS), in collaboration with the General Services Administration (GSA), is seeking to acquire technical writing services to enhance the documentation for its Electronic Benefits System (EBS) Training Branch. This initiative aims to support the mission-critical systems, namely the Electronic Immigration System (ELIS) and Benefits Hub, by providing high-quality training materials. The overarching goal is to empower system users to navigate these systems efficiently and perform essential case management tasks with ease.

The scope of work involves developing, maintaining, and improving user manuals and quick reference guides (QRGs) that align with system updates and user needs. The contractor will be responsible for creating documentation that enhances operational efficiency while minimizing user errors. This will include comprehensive user manuals with step-by-step instructions, visual aids, troubleshooting guides, and QRGs for high-frequency tasks. All documentation must comply with federal guidelines, plain language principles, and agency branding requirements.

Contractors are expected to provide experienced technical writers proficient in software documentation, 508 compliance, and plain language principles. They must utilize modern tools for developing and maintaining documentation while establishing structured processes for drafting and updating materials in collaboration with subject matter experts (SMEs). The deliverables should optimize accessibility through digital formats compatible with the agency's platforms.

Through this solicitation, DHS seeks performance-based services that meet or exceed its requirements for technical documentation. The contractor will implement effective project management processes to ensure regular progress reporting and timely delivery of milestones. Additionally, a version control system will be established to maintain consistency in documentation updates while fostering effective communication between the contractor and agency stakeholders.
